KULMETOVO DRAWINGS

KULMETOVO DRAWINGS, an archaeological site of the Eneolithic period. It is located on the rocky outcrops of the right bank of the Ai River, 3—4 km to the west from Derevnya Kulmetovo of Kiginsky Raion. Discovered and studied in 1988 by V.N.Shirokov. KUMERTAU

KUMERTAU, a town and railway station in the RB. Located the S of Bashkir Urals, 237 km S of Ufa. Territory — 170 km2. Population — 64.1 thous. people (2017). KUMYS

KUMYS, traditional fermented milk drink of the Bashkir cuisine made of mare, less often goat milk, known for its healing properties. KUMYS THERAPY

KUMYS THERAPY, a medical use of kumys. Kumys contains easily digested proteins, vitamins, microelements, unsaturated fatty acids and other substances that determine its therapeutic action. KUNGAK

KUNGAK, a zoological wildlife reserve of area 3.8 thous. ha near the Meleuz. It was organized to protect the habitat of the fresh‑water turtle and to restore the populations of valuable and rare animal species (2002). KUNGYR-BUGA

KUNGYR-BUGA, a monumental epic work of Bashkir literature. Written in a combined poetic and prosaic form. First recorded by R.G.Ignatyev and published in 1865 in the Orenburgskiye Gubernskiye Vedomosti magazine. KURAY

KURAY, a Bashkir wind instrument. It is made from the stem of the Ural rib­bearing plant. It is a tube 570–810 mm long and about 20 mm in diameter with 5 holes (4 holes on the front, 1 on the back).
